Enzyme are protein molecules that catalyzes chemical reaction.
In DNA replication, enzymes play a major role.
Enzymes identify the starting point of replication, attach itself and then unwind the Deoxyribonucleotide acid DNA Strand to form the replication fork.
Enzyme Helicase unwind and breaks the hydrogen bond between the base pair, opening up the helix structure to form a template for the new strand.
DNA polymerase also play a major role, it synthesis new DNA by adding primer to the DNA sequence for replication to occur, they also proof read the copy of DNA Strand being made to avoid errors during replication and add nucleotide to the growing DNA strand.
